Penny Lab Understanding the Scientific Method
Pre-LAB (Make an Observation) l Make a Qualitative observation of the lab l Make a Quantitative observation of the lab
l Water has the ability to “stick to itself” (cohesion) and create a force when together (surface tension). l Purpose: To determine if soapy water droplets will stick together better on a penny surface compared to tap water droplets due to cohesion and surface tension properties.
Make a Hypothesis l Consider the following: • How many water drops will fit on a penny? • How many water drops will fit on a penny if the water is mixed with soap?
Experiment l How many drops of water will fit on a penny without spilling? l How many drops of soapy water will fit on a penny without spilling?
Record Data l Make a Data Table Water Type Tap Water Soapy Water Trial 1 Trial 2 Trial 3 Trial 4 Average
Analyze Data l Using the data you collected, explain your results (in 2 complete sentences). • What did your average data show? (The penny held more of which water type? ) • Why did you test each water type more than once?
l Make a Conclusion (5 sentences) Was your hypothesis correct? • Why or Why Not? l Was there a control in the experiment? l What was the purpose of: • Independent variable of the experiment? l What did your results show about surface tension (water “sticking to itself”)? l Errors? ?
